Output 2584edf1c00463d7fb75756c688ff2d24e41e5c1c7bd98f2c421c51238ac1ac5:88

value
34700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d786ac901c2bc0d7ab647cd9bc6f5089be8fcbb2 OP_EQUAL
address
3MLcY76prP2EryrX8u4cHGys4gu8YFmJjn
transaction
2584edf1c00463d7fb75756c688ff2d24e41e5c1c7bd98f2c421c51238ac1ac5
confirmations
181788
spent
true